Output df94bf102e752ab59f4eec25bd2e3a8258794334adfde87cd742fc10a292dd32:0

value
25320
script pubkey
OP_0 OP_PUSHBYTES_32 03d881a2e59650401b59a916f7ab5f3ad9cadc1026ca77802fb6c502e2e5f1bc
address
bc1qq0vgrgh9jegyqx6e4yt0026l8tvu4hqsym980qp0kmzs9ch97x7qy3q49x
transaction
df94bf102e752ab59f4eec25bd2e3a8258794334adfde87cd742fc10a292dd32
confirmations
24139
spent
true